> Here at Draper we only change the gases when they are “empty”, by that I
> mean we set a bottom limit for liquids by keeping them on a scale. For true
> gases we send the bottle back empty if we can. Some time there is just not
> enough gas left in the bottle to finish a day so we would change it early.
>
>
>
> We keep a log of all weights and pressures so we can monitor and try to
> estimate when it would need to be changed so that we have a spare on hand.

> We are wondering how often do you change the RIE process gases even the
> gases are not run out. We have been told that they should be changed in max
> 3 years even if they are almost full but we have been using some of them
> (SF6, C4F8, CHF3)  for 5 years and we didn't realize any process-related
> critical problems during the dry etching process.
>
> Have you ever faced with any problems for Fluorine and Chlorine based
> gases in your institutes?
